Transaction 5c9143050c78dc0718d0f80f059deebd2e3105436e7b91952117407e5b333595
1 Input
1 Output
-
5c9143050c78dc0718d0f80f059deebd2e3105436e7b91952117407e5b333595:0
- value
- 2597320
- script pubkey
- OP_0 OP_PUSHBYTES_20 765c96b8f6e033f809eb0ff44d9757e986f5812b
- address
- bc1qwewfdw8kuqelsz0tpl6ym96haxr0tqftsrxgpf